About the role

CACI is seeking an experienced System Engineer, Senior to support logistics operations across the Indo-Pacific. The System Engineer, Senior serves as CACI's senior technical professional responsible for designing, integrating, implementing, and sustaining enterprise information technology and systems engineering solutions that support logistics, mission support, operational planning, and command and control capabilities.

Reporting directly to the Program Manager, this position provides technical leadership to ensure secure, reliable, and scalable systems support mission execution across distributed and contested environments. The System Engineer, Senior works closely with Government stakeholders, program leadership, software developers, network engineers, cybersecurity personnel, system administrators, and mission partners to develop and maintain integrated technology solutions supporting operational requirements.
